Lenguaje de Programación Concepto, tipos y ejemplos

Además, el marco de trabajo Ruby on Rails (RoR) aporta muchas ventajas, como la mejora de la seguridad de las aplicaciones web, el bajo mantenimiento y la idoneidad para el desarrollo full-stack. Conoce el concepto del objeto en programación y aprende a crear uno para tu programa. Aprende las profesiones más populares de la tecnología de la información y descubre qué carrera seguir al finalizar el curso. Puedes descargar todas las herramientas en español en la web oficial de Ruby.

lenguaje de programación

Pero sí es una buena elección si ya has aprendido algunos de los citados aquí y dominas la programación. Es un lenguaje básico que no permite hacer cosas demasiado complejas, pero sirve para aprender los fundamentos https://imagendeveracruz.mx/nacional/un-bootcamp-de-programacion-que-te-ensena-las-profesiones-ti-del-manana/50470348 de la programación. De esta forma si creas un juego o una app en Blocky obtendrás el código en esos lenguajes, aunque no los conozcas, y podrás usarlo allá donde se necesite un programa en JavaScript, PHP, etc.

Conversión a código de máquina

La clase Applet es un componente del AWT (Abstract Window Toolkit), que permite al applet mostrar una interfaz gráfica de usuario o GUI (Graphical User Interface), y responder a eventos generados por el usuario. En el 2005 se calculaba en 4,5 millones el número de desarrolladores y 2500 millones de dispositivos habilitados con tecnología Java. Desde J2SE 1.4, la evolución del lenguaje ha sido regulada por el JCP (Java Community Process), que usa Java Specification Requests (JSRs) para proponer y especificar cambios en la plataforma Java. El lenguaje en sí mismo está especificado en la Java Language Specification (JLS), o Especificación del Lenguaje Java. Fue creado hace poco tiempo, siendo orientado al desarrollo de aplicaciones para MacOS e iOS, sin embargo, también puede ser ejecutado en Linux. Estos 6 ejemplos son solo algunos de los lenguajes más populares, pero hay muchos más, y se debe a que cada uno funciona de manera distinta.

  • Todo en Java es un objeto (salvo algunas excepciones), y todo en Java reside en alguna clase (recordemos que una clase es un molde a partir del cual pueden crearse varios objetos).
  • Los desarrolladores de aplicaciones móviles usan lenguajes de programación como JavaScript, Java, Swift, Kotlin y Dart.
  • Es uno de los lenguajes de programación más empleados en la actualidad y su popularidad sigue al alza.
  • Pero a diferencia de este, que combina la sintaxis para programación genérica, estructurada y orientada a objetos, Java fue construido desde el principio para ser completamente orientado a objetos.
  • El método service() puede lanzar (throws) excepciones de tipo ServletException e IOException si ocurre algún tipo de anomalía.
  • Aquí tienes 25 cursos online que están dirigidos a principiantes y que son obra de algunas de las compañías más reconocidas del sector.

Por ejemplo, un programador podría escribir una línea de código que le diga a la computadora que muestre un mensaje en la pantalla. La computadora lee ese código y lo convierte en una serie de instrucciones que la máquina puede comprender y ejecutar. El lenguaje C es muy empleado porque puede ser utilizado para desarrollar programas de diversa naturaleza, como lenguajes de programación, manejadores de bases de datos o sistemas operativos. Su sintaxis es compacta, ya que emplea pocas funciones y palabras reservadas, comparado con otros lenguajes, como Java; además, es portable, toda vez que se utiliza en varios sistemas operativos y hardware. La gramática necesaria para especificar un lenguaje de programación puede ser clasificada por su posición en la Jerarquía de Chomsky.

JavaScript

Si quieres ahorrar tiempo puedes probar Ruby on Rails, una serie de herramientas basadas en Ruby ya creadas, que sirven para crear páginas web de forma sencilla. Está pensado para que los niños y principiantes aprendan programación de forma sencilla. Code Studio, su plataforma educativa, utiliza diferentes lenguajes visuales, alguno de ellos propios como CS, para enseñar a programar. bootcamp de programación Tras superar una serie de cursos online para diferentes edades, se puede acceder a cursos más avanzados en Javascript, C, Python, y otros lenguajes profesionales. Aunque Scratch no es un lenguaje profesional, sirve perfectamente para crear tus primeras apps, y para aprender los conceptos de la programación que después te van a ser muy útiles en otros lenguajes más avanzados.

  • Por ejemplo, un desarrollador web puede escoger JavaScript porque funciona mejor con HTML, mientras que un creador de videojuegos puede preferir C++ porque puede procesar gráficos más complejos.
  • Python se convirtió en uno de los lenguajes más populares y se usa en una amplia gama de aplicaciones, desde desarrollo web hasta inteligencia artificial y análisis de datos.
  • Por lo tanto, para nosotros es claro que “dois canetas” se refiere a la cantidad de bolígrafos que tenemos.
  • Java no soporta expansión de código ensamblador, aunque las aplicaciones pueden acceder a características de bajo nivel usando bibliotecas nativas (JNI, Java Native Interfaces).
  • A medida que la tecnología avanza, también lo hacen los lenguajes de programación.

Leave a Comment

อีเมลของคุณจะไม่แสดงให้คนอื่นเห็น ช่องข้อมูลจำเป็นถูกทำเครื่องหมาย *